Phone Communication Symbol
The phone communication symbol is a widely recognized icon that represents the act of connecting via telephone. This common symbol often depicts a handset, sometimes in conjunction with a speakerphone. It is frequently used in apps to signal phone-related features. For example, you might see this symbol on a button that begins a phone call or when viewing directory listings. The simplicity of the phone communication symbol makes it easily recognizable across languages, contributing to its widespread use.
